Story of the game for Canada is the gunners, Heslip and Rautins. Mexico comes out in the third and cuts it to a one point game, Heslip comes in and scores 9 to create a cushion, Mexico pulls close again at the end of the third, Rautins with 9 straight to build the lead again. Those two stretches were the most important in the game.

Yeah, this is a massive win in terms of finishing top 4. If you assume that Canada beats the teams that are significantly worse than them (Uruguay, plus probably Mexico and Venezuela), then really the only way they don't qualify is if they lose to both Argentina and Dominican Republic, and Brazil beats both those teams. Still, Canada can't let up; the wheels have fallen off for this team in the past, they need to use this tournament as a statement that things are different now.
